#253d5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#253d5e is composed of 14.5% red, 23.9%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 35.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 214.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 25.7%. #253d5e color hex could be obtained by blending #4a7abc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#253d5e color description : Very dark blue.
#253d5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#253d5e has RGB values of R:37, G:61,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 2440542.

Shades and Tints of #253d5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060a is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#253d5e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4145 is the less saturated color, while #023781 is the most saturated one.
